Publication number: 20080199108Abstract: A fitment for a liquid containing pouch wherein the fitment is attached to the top portion of the pouch by sealing the top portion of the pouch together and to the sealing portion of the fitment. The fitment having a straw therein and a removeable cap for sealing the liquid in the pouch. The cap can be removed to allow access to the straw and the liquid in the pouch. The cap ban be replaced on the fitment to reseal the pouch. Since the straw is already in the fitment it is easier to use than liquid containing pouches where the straw has to be inserted into the pouch by breaking a seal. Further the straw in the fitment helps prevent spills and injuries associated with straws having to break the seal of the pouch.Type: ApplicationFiled: June 22, 2006Publication date: August 21, 2008Applicant: WFCP, LLCInventor: William D. Publication number: 20030232682Abstract: The Automatic Variable Ratio Differential is a multi-purpose device which represents a substantial improvement over current vehicle differential technology. Its primary use is as an improved vehicle differential, allowing the driving wheels to rotate at different speeds when the vehicle is turning. The improvement over the standard differential becomes evident when one of the driving wheels is slipping due to mud or ice; then, the AVRD uses a true mechanical ratio to channel the available torque to the driving wheel with traction, thereby preventing the vehicle from becoming stuck. This device is much more efficient, durable, and powerful than the conventional friction driven limited-slip differentials currently available. In many configurations, the device can also improve the maneuverability and turning-radius of a vehicle by allowing the inside wheel in a turn to rotate in reverse while the outside wheel rotates forward.Type: ApplicationFiled: March 14, 2003Publication date: December 18, 2003Inventors: William D.
